Featherweight Features:
  • Made with high-performance UA materials, designed to be worn all day & when playing sports
  • Lightweight, breathable knit fabric on outer is water-resistant
  • Lightweight open-cell foam lets air through but makes it hard for moisture & sweat to pass
  • UA Iso-Chill fabric on interior lining & ear loops feels cool to the touch for as long as you wear it
  • Fabric is soft & smooth for next to face comfort & moves moisture from your mouth to the insert layer
  • Built-in UPF 50+ sun protection
  • Structured design sits up off the face & lips for added comfort & breathability
  • Soft, adjustable nose bridge with suede-like anti-slip material to secure it across the face

measure from bridge of nose to center of ear

xs/sm
5 1/2 inch
to 5 3/8 inch


sm/md
5 1/2
to 5 7/8


md/lg
6
to 6 1/2 inch


lg/xl
6 1/2
to 6 7/8


xl/2xl
7+
